T. Rowe Price is trying its luck in India.
Reuters reports that the asset manager is shelling out between $125 million and $135 million for a 26 percent stake in the oldest mutual fund firm in India,
UTI Asset Management.
The move may not surprise fundsters. On December 30 the
Wall Street Journal reported that T. Rowe was one of the bidders for just such a stake in UTI.
